Transaction 8222510218831a41853561e35cde6ea4ae87188c589b0784b3f11f5bef11a687
1 Input
1 Output
-
8222510218831a41853561e35cde6ea4ae87188c589b0784b3f11f5bef11a687:0
- value
- 32979376
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b7ba89357e939596193706b6e03294d1c27259b2 OP_EQUAL
- address
- 3JSV3Pt4wwB44WLs794thwXfm8D1V2p85T